A University of Benin (UNIBEN) lecturer, Professor Godspowe Osaretin Ikuobase, and a 2023 presidential hopeful has condemned the present politicking in Nigeria, which he noted had been commercialised.
Ikuobase, who said he aimed to become the next president under the umbrella of the All Progressives Congress (APC) lamented that those with integrity and the necessary intelligence were few in the nation’s politics.
The Professor of Service Computing, who made the assertion while fielding questions from journalists in Benin City, urged people with integrity, intelligence, energy and proper planning to come into politics so as to enable the nation to get it right politically.
“Politicking presently in Nigeria is unfortunate, it is seen as a business venture as against service to the nation. But we must change the way we politick and choose our leaders,” Professor Ikuobase submitted.
“For us to get its right politically, we must elect people of integrity, intelligence and energy. We must choose knowledge over financial wealth. We need proper planning, core nationalist, a detribalised Nigerians to take the country into political Eldorado,” he advised.
“I want to advise Nigerians that we should not elect powerful leaders but powerful institutions. Older politicians should stay behind the scene and be advisers to the youths,” the university don added.
He disclosed that his choice to contest the forthcoming presidential primaries of the APC was informed by his quest to making positive and developmental strides in the country.
“I am coming to implement the true spirit of the APC which is politics for the grassroots, from the grassroots and by the grassroots. Those pushing to rule the country are only relying on their financial muscles and what they stand to benefit from and are not ready to offer solutions to the country’s problem.
“So I have an agenda which is christened “MEAL” ( maintenance, Electricity and Energy, Agriculture and Leadership) and is aimed at emancipating Nigeria from its political dungeon. We need youth that is educated, that has transcended beyond materialism, that has come to value integrity and excellence above wealth as president, that is the person of Professor Godspower Osaretin Ikuobase,” he canvassed.
Speaking on the issue of banditry in the country, Ikuobase, said that banditry is caused by hunger and unemployment, maintaining that Nigerians are known for peace and hard-working, just as he promised to engage the youths through agriculture if elected.
